+Wed Sep 10 14:05:08 1997 Jim Wilson <wilson@cygnus.com>
+
+ * Makefile.in (testsuite/site.exp): New target.
+ (check-gcc, check-g++): Depend on testsuite/site.exp.
+ Don't stop for failure.
+
Wed Sep 10 10:51:21 1997 Jeffrey A Law (law@cygnus.com)
* expr.c (emit_block_move): Always return a value.
check: $(CHECK_TARGETS)
-check-g++: site.exp
+testsuite/site.exp: site.exp
if [ -d testsuite ]; then \
true; \
else \
fi
rm -rf testsuite/site.exp
cp site.exp testsuite/site.exp
- rootme=`pwd`; export rootme; \
+
+check-g++: testsuite/site.exp
+ -rootme=`pwd`; export rootme; \
srcdir=`cd ${srcdir}; pwd` ; export srcdir ; \
cd testsuite; \
EXPECT=${EXPECT} ; export EXPECT ; \
export TCL_LIBRARY ; fi ; \
$(RUNTEST) --tool g++ $(RUNTESTFLAGS)
-check-gcc: site.exp
- if [ -d testsuite ]; then \
- true; \
- else \
- mkdir testsuite; \
- fi
- rm -rf testsuite/site.exp
- cp site.exp testsuite/site.exp
- rootme=`pwd`; export rootme; \
+check-gcc: testsuite/site.exp
+ -rootme=`pwd`; export rootme; \
srcdir=`cd ${srcdir}; pwd` ; export srcdir ; \
cd testsuite; \
EXPECT=${EXPECT} ; export EXPECT ; \